Tense and Text in Classical Arabic : : A Discourse-oriented Study of the Classical Arabic Tense System / / Michal Marmorstein.
This study undertakes to examine the problem of the tenses in Classical Arabic. While aware of the long tradition which shaped the discussion of this subject, and building, in fact, on some important insights offered by medieval and modern grammarians, this study attempts to redefine the discussion...
